Intel Arc A750 vs Intel Arc B570

We compared two Desktop platform GPUs: 8GB VRAM Arc A750 and 10GB VRAM Arc B570 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

Intel Arc A750 's Advantages
Larger VRAM bandwidth (512.0GB/s vs 380.0GB/s)
1280 additional rendering cores
Intel Arc B570 's Advantages
Released 2 years and 3 months late
Boost Clock has increased by 4% (2500MHz vs 2400MHz)
More VRAM (10GB vs 8GB)
Lower TDP (150W vs 225W)
